Sensors act given that the eyes and ears of an automated procedure. These important gadgets detect and measure a big selection of Bodily parameters, like temperature, force, flow fee, stage, proximity, and even chemical composition. The data collected by sensors forms the inspiration for knowledgeable choice-creating in the automatic course of action. Differing kinds of sensors cater to precise desires: thermocouples check temperature, stress transducers evaluate pressure for every unit location, circulation meters monitor the motion of fluids, and proximity sensors detect the presence or absence of objects. The precision, dependability, and responsiveness of such sensors instantly affect the general general performance and effectiveness of your automated process.
In hazardous industrial environments addressing flammable gases, liquids, or dust, explosion protection is paramount. Specialised tools and systems are meant to avoid ignitions and comprise explosions, safeguarding personnel, property, and the surrounding ecosystem. This requires adhering to stringent protection requirements and employing a variety of strategies. Intrinsically Protected circuits Restrict electrical Strength to amounts incapable of creating ignition, when explosion-proof enclosures are designed to withstand inside explosions and stop flame propagation. Understanding and utilizing correct explosion security steps is not merely a regulatory necessity but a essential element of dependable industrial operation.
The Mind at the rear of any automatic industrial course of action would be the Management technique. These techniques obtain alerts from sensors, method this info according to pre-programmed logic, and afterwards concern instructions to actuators together with other automation devices to execute wished-for Industrial automation actions. Programmable Logic Controllers (PLCs) are definitely the workhorses of industrial Manage, featuring sturdy and dependable authentic-time Manage abilities. Supervisory Command and Details Acquisition (SCADA) techniques give a broader overview, enabling operators to watch and Management big-scale industrial processes from a central area. Contemporary Manage programs are significantly incorporating advanced algorithms, synthetic intelligence, and device Finding out to enhance performance, forecast routine maintenance desires, and adapt to shifting problems.
The Actual physical execution of automated tasks relies on a diverse number of automation tools. This classification encompasses a big selection of machinery and equipment, such as industrial robots for tasks like welding, portray, and assembly; actuators (for instance electrical motors, pneumatic cylinders, and hydraulic techniques) that offer the Bodily force and motion; conveyors for product managing; and specialised machinery suitable for unique industrial processes. The selection and integration of appropriate automation gear are important for achieving the desired level of automation and effectiveness.
